Keystone Building Company, Inc. was founded in September of 1995 primarily as a single-family home construction company. The
company has since expanded into multi-family, light commercial construction, and land development. Keystone has grown from a
one-man operation into nine employees that have built approximately 400 homes in the Birmingham area.
Keystone has been named as one of the top 10 largest homebuilders in the Birmingham, AL area for the past four years by Birmingham
Business Journal. Keystone has also received great recognition during the Parade of Homes with 4 Gold awards, 5 Silver awards and
2 Bronze awards over the last six years. Keystone has become known in the Birmingham real estate market for developing and building
cutting edge projects in niche areas. In the years to come, the company plans on expanding its multi-family and commercial markets,
as well as expanding the land development side of the business.
Keystone has been able to attract some of the best talent in the building industry and plans on continued steady controlled growth.
We are very appreciative of having good, hardworking employees that are dedicated to completing a well built project in an efficient
and safe manner.
Cory Mason
President
Cory was born and raised in Shelby County, Alabama and is a third generation homebuilder. He attended Auburn University where he
acquired a Bachelor of Science in Building Construction. In 1995 he started Keystone Building Company, Inc. as a one-man operation
and has since expanded the company into multi-family residences, light commercial construction, and land development with projects
in both Shelby and Jefferson County. Cory has served as President of the South Chapter of the Greater Birmingham Association of
Home Builders in 2000 and remains active as a member of the GBAHB. In his free time he enjoys hunting, snow skiing, and spending
time with his wife Liz and his dog Sugar.
